Steps to make Roasted Kohlrabi:

  1. Peel the skin from the kohlrabi and cut into bite-sized pieces. (I cut the kohlrabi in the main photo vertically into 12 slices.)
  2. Line an oven-safe dish with parchment paper. Coat the kohlrabi with the ◇ ingredients and then roast at 250°C for 10-13 minutes.
  3. Pour the red into a small pot. Turn on the heat and cook off the alcohol. Add the remaining ingredients and simmer until thickened.
  4. Move Step 2 to a plate, top with Step 3, and it’s done.
  5. In German, Kohl means Cabbage and Rabi means Turnip. It has tons of potassium and 3-4 times more vitamin C than turnips.
  6. Kohlrabi can apparently help prevent high pressure, help create beautiful skin, and improve the immune system, etc. 1 (500 g) kohlrabi = approximately 105 calories.
